Definition
命令 (mìnglìng) is the most common, neutral word for 'order' or 'command' — used in both everyday and formal contexts. 令 (lìng) is more formal and often appears in set phrases or military language (e.g., 军令). 指令 (zhǐlìng) refers to a specific instruction or directive, typical in technical or bureaucratic settings.
verb
to orderto command
noun
an ordera command
Measure word · 道, 个
Examples
- 命令。Tā mìng lìng wǒ lìjí tíngzhǐ gōngzuò.He ordered me to stop working immediately.
- 命令。Lǎobǎn xià le yí dào mìng lìng.The boss issued an order.
- 命令。Nǐ bìxū fúcóng shàngjí de mìng lìng.You must obey the orders of your superior.
